Doximity is an online networking service for medical professionals. Launched in 2010, the platform offers its members curated medical news, telehealth tools, and case collaboration.
Omega Healthcare Investors Inc is a specialized real estate investment trust that owns, leases and manages healthcare-related real estate assets, mainly including skilled nursing facilities, senior housing and long-term care facilities across the U.S. and UK. It partners with healthcare operators to provide stable real estate support for quality patient care delivery.
